Slope stability protection structure suitable for plateau permafrost region
The invention relates to the technical field of side slope protection, in particular to a side slope stable protection structure suitable for a plateau permafrost region, which comprises a freeze-thaw layer and a top surface located on a side slope, a plurality of sash beams are arranged on the surface of the freeze-thaw layer, the sash beams are fixed on the slope surface, and freeze-thaw soil of the freeze-thaw layer is filled in the sash beams. An elastic piece is arranged at the bottom of the frame beam structure and comprises an elastic flow guide groove plate, and the elastic flow guide groove plate has the soil filtering and water draining functions and can stretch and deform to solve the problem that an existing slope protection structure is unstable and damaged under the freezing and thawing action of slope soil, and the stability of the slope protection structure in the freezing and thawing cycle process is enhanced.
